ASL31X
XM 2-stage Low Noise Amplifier
Features
· 30 dB Gain at 2338 MHz
· -12 dBm IP1dB at 2338 MHz
· 0.7 dB NF at 2338 MHz
· Two-stage LNA
Description
ASL31X is a two-stage LNA, which has a low
noise, high gain, and high linearity for XM
application. The amplifier is available in a DFN-6
package and passes the stringent DC, RF, and
reliability tests.
